Kids Concert III @ Longfellow Elementary School
When Fri, June 18, 6pm – 7pm
Where Auditorium, 1065 E. Washington Blvd., Pasadena


Description Welcome summer with a Summer Solstice presentation of string instrument and choral music. This FREE concert is part of the Verdugo Young Musicians Association (VYMA) Music Project at Longfellow Elementary School, which was launched September 2009 as an after-school music education program. In partnership with Pasadena LEARNS, the program provides free instruments and classical musical instruction to students in grades 1 to 6. The performance includes choir, orchestra, chamber ensemble and Kindergartners demonstration as a musical bonus. The project is inspired by El Sistema, the successful Venezuelan music education model that produced LA Philharmonic Music Director Gustavo Dudamel. Admission is free, but donations are accepted. FREE Pasadena Chalk Festival @ Paseo Colorado
When Sat, June 19, 10am – 7pm
Where Near Macy's, 400 E. Colorado Blvd., Pasadena


Description For centuries, artists have painted beautiful images on the streets of great cities, using chalk as their medium and the street pavement as their canvas. The Pasadena Chalk Festival continues the legacy of the street painting art form. Hundreds of Madonnari (Italian for street painter) coming from all across Southern California will use over 25,000 pieces of chalk will attempt to establish a world record creating spectacular murals on concrete areas the size of two city blocks.
